How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Rose Village?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rose Village Studio Apartments | $1,533 | $1,128 | $1,850 |
| Rose Village 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,895 | $1,195 | $3,659 |
| Rose Village 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,318 | $1,225 | $6,995 |
| Rose Village 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,277 | $1,518 | $4,375 |
| Rose Village 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,560 | $2,560 | $2,560 |

Getting Around the Rose Village Neighborhood in Vancouver, WA
Walk Score®
69 / 100
Somewhat Walkable
Some err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
74 / 100
Very Bikeable
Biking is convenient for most trips
Transit Score®
44 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
